Locavore Dinner and Cooking Class Slated at Kristofer’s

The Inn at Kristofer’s has announced that their May 13 gourmet dinner and cooking demonstration will be locally focused.

The “Locavore Gourmet Dinner and Demonstration Cooking Class” includes a five-course dinner, featuring ingredients from Door County and Wisconsin, two glasses of wine selected by co-owner Chris Milligan, champagne upon arrival, plus a one-hour cooking demonstration by co-owner and executive chef Terri Milligan.

“Spring in Door County means our delicious, fresh, local ingredients are on their way to our menu,” explained Chef Terri Milligan. “Door County asparagus as well as locally foraged ramps, from my own backyard, as well as morel mushrooms should be popping up soon – and here at Kristofer’s we are excited to again be incorporating these delicious items in our dishes.”

To start, patrons will enjoy a Door County Kir made with champagne and Door County cherry juice coupled with a chef’s choice of amuse bouche (small appetizer samplings) composed of locally picked ingredients.

The five-course dinner will include an appetizer of Washington Island flatbread with caramelized fennel, shallots, Wisconsin made fresh mozzarella and herbs. The evening’s salad will feature Wisconsin made cheese followed by a homemade sorbet cleanser. The main course will be fresh Columbia River Salmon topped with Door County asparagus, ramps and, hopefully, morels! For dessert, Chef Milligan will treat participants to her individual brown sugar meringue baked Alaska made with homemade Door County cherry ice cream.
